"well balanced smoke"
got a box of five two years ago from Escazu near San Jose in CR while on holiday. Maybe its the ageing in my humidor but I don't find it to taste "green" at all.. still one to go; three out of four had a great draw.medium mild, old leather on the palate with a hint of spice in the aftertaste. will buy again

"Green"
I received this cigar in a sample pack. It was a beautiful looking cigar, with the red and gold band. Upon taking a draw before lighting, I noticed a pleasant flavor although the draw was a little tight. Once I put fire to this thing, the flavor turned strange. I sinced a taste that I can only describe as green. It tasted like I was smoking a plant from my garden or something. In addition, there was a crack in the lower part of the cigar, so it was very hard to get any smoke without a forceful pull on the stick. Even after this negative experience, I am not willing to give up on these smokes. They come packaged in the nicest box that I have seen other than my humidor. I just have a feeling that this cigar manufacturer is on to something, if we can just be patient enough to wait for it to arrive.
